The invention discloses an automatic ship control system capable of automatically replacing and cleaning a ship bottom shell, a ship equipped with the system does not need to go back to a port to clean aquatic organisms parasitic on the ship bottom for a long time and other engineering of repairing the ship bottom, and only needs to drive a transmission control device in a ship cabin through a control system, and rotary replacment of a prepared ship shell is performed, and an old ship shell is rotated into the cabin through a rotating shaft to be repaired and cleaned; through the method, the service life of the ship bottom can be greatly prolonged, and a guarantee is provided for long-term driving of the ship on the sea.
